Gamescom Asia and Thailand Game Show have joined forces to create Gamescom Asia x Thailand Game Show.
Scheduled to launch in October, the organizations stated that this merger “brings together the strengths of both realms: a robust global business and consumer platform alongside an exhilarating fan-centric gaming experience.”
Previously, Gamescom Asia welcomed over 40,000 participants from 78 different countries and showcased 177 exhibitors in 2024, while the Thailand Game Show attracted more than 185,000 visitors and featured 50 exhibitors.
